United Verde Mine: Legacy, Innovation, and Green Revival

Reviving a Historic American Mine for the Modern Era

Located in Jerome, Arizona, the United Verde Mine epitomizes both America’s rich mining legacy and the evolution of sustainable mineral resource extraction. Once one of the most productive copper and gold mines in the early 20th century, United Verde’s activity waned after decades of intensive mining. However, 2025 marks a renewed interest in leveraging its considerable mineral deposits using modern, eco-conscious practices.

  • United Verde’s copper is critical for modern electrical infrastructure, renewable energy systems, and electric vehicles.
  • New mining operations focus on sustainability, deploying AI-driven resource modelling and precision drilling to reduce environmental impact.
  • Water recycling and renewable energy integration in facilities have drastically reduced the overall carbon footprint of operations.

The revival of United Verde is emblematic of the accelerating global shift toward green resources and advanced resource management. Notably, these changes are in line with increasing regulatory pressures, community expectations, and the need to attract regional investment.

Serra Verde Rare Earths: Brazil’s Strategic Green Frontier

Emerging as a Global Leader in Rare Earths

Serra Verde Rare Earths, located in northern Brazil, occupies a critical position in the global supply chain for rare earth elements (REEs). These minerals are essential for advanced technologies—powering everything from wind turbines and electric vehicles to defence applications and high-efficiency motors. The world’s rising pursuit of green technologies means that securing a reliable, sustainable REE source is a top national and industrial priority in 2025–2026, extending well into the future.

Sustainable Extraction: The Serra Verde Approach

  • Advanced Bioleaching Techniques: Harnessing microbial processes for mineral extraction, drastically reducing the need for harsh chemicals and lowering contaminant risks to the sensitive Amazon basin environment.
  • Minimal Tailings and Waste: Bioleaching cuts down on toxic byproducts, minimizing environmental hazards, and supporting robust biodiversity conservation efforts.

Serra Verde’s responsible methods demonstrate how rare earth development can move away from the heavily polluting practices of past decades, focusing on renewable energy, the protection of local communities, and the safeguarding of regional ecosystems.

Global Implications: Copper & REEs for Green Technologies

The sustainable production of copper at United Verde Mine and rare earths at Serra Verde forms the backbone of the rapidly expanding clean energy and electric vehicle markets.

Why Copper Matters

  • Essential for Renewable Energy Systems: Large-scale wind, solar, and hydro installations rely on copper for connections and conductors.
  • Electric Vehicles: Each new EV contains up to 80 kg of copper, making a sustainable supply chain vital for the global mobility transition.
  • National Infrastructure: Reliable domestic copper resources help the U.S. meet infrastructure upgrade targets without relying on volatile import markets.

The Critical Role of Rare Earth Elements (REEs)

  • Enabling Clean Technologies: REEs produce the super-strong magnets required for advanced motors, wind turbine generators, and more.
  • Supporting Defence and High-Tech Sectors: Rare earth oxides are indispensable for strategic applications such as radars, lasers, and aerospace technologies.
  • Reducing Geopolitical Risk: By diversifying the rare earth supply beyond traditional Asian sources, projects like Serra Verde improve supply security and market stability.

Combined, these developments create resilient supply chains essential to both national security and global climate commitments.
